Wave Wizards Surf Club launches 2017 with a competition at Umhlanga Beach.

WAVE Wizards Surf Club has big plans for 2017, and starts its year off with a bang with the first surfing competition planned for Saturday, 11 February.

Entries are open for the event, which will be at Umhlanga’s Bronze Beach. The age groups will range from novices in both boys and girls divisions to masters, and all surfers are welcome to enjoy a day of fun with family and friends.

Lizzard Surf and Hurricane Surf are both supporting the club in 2017, and club chairman, Jestyn Vijoen, said the intention is to develop new youngsters in surfing, as well as encourage the older surfers to enjoy the community aspect of the sport.

Vijoen said: “We plan to run at least four events this year. We will be crowning series winners and will take a surfer’s top two results of at least three events surfed. Wave Wizards Club has been the breeding ground for many successful international world surfers. This year we want to bring back the culture of ‘fun in the sun with the whole family’ and get the kids involved in judging. We welcome surfers from all regions to join.”
